"Human immunodeficiency virus-specific CD8+ T cells are highly sensitive to spontaneous and CD95/Fas-induced apoptosis, and this sensitivity may impair their ability to control HIV infection.
"To elucidate the mechanism behind this sensitivity, in this study we examined the levels of antiapoptotic molecules Bcl-2 and Bcl-xL in HIV-specific CD8+ T cells from HIV-infected individuals," scientists writing in the Journal of Immunology report.
